Definition of an NGO

NGO stands for Non-Governmental Organization, it is a voluntary group which does not aim at profits and does not have the government as its controlling authority. Community and societal problems related to education, environment, healthcare, and human rights are the focus of NGOs.

Besides making profits, the main goal of an NGO is to bring about a positive change in the society by carrying out welfare activities and campaigns.

Major Features of NGOs

  • Non-profit and charitable organizations
  • Mainly involved in social welfare and community enhancement
  • Independent of government management
  • Funded by donations, grants, sponsorships, and volunteers
  • Determined to bring about sustainable social change

NGOs frequently serve as a platform for the defenseless and the last in the line to raise their voice and seek help from the society.

The Role of NGOs in India

There is a long list of social problems in India such as poverty, illiteracy, healthcare disparity, unemployment, and environmental degradation. NGOs dedicate themselves to solving these problems and promoting government policies.

In what ways do NGOs help community

1. Education for Everyone

A large number of NGOs extend their helping hand to children belonging to families with low economic status. Initiatives include offering scholarships, supplying educational materials, running computer education programs, and providing training for various skills.

2. Healthcare Assistance

Healthcare-oriented NGOs carry out organizing medical camps, health awareness campaigns, blood donation camps, and help to patients who cannot afford treatment.

3. Women Empowerment

Through skill training programs, NGOs enable women to access education, employment opportunities, legal assistance, and financial independence.

4. Child Welfare

The goal of child welfare programs is to provide at-risk children with education, nutrition, healthcare, and protection.

5. Community Development

NGOs cooperate with local communities to raise living standards through sanitation initiatives, employment generation, and awareness programs.
